Introduction Most gray matter volumetric studies use T1-weighted imaging such as MP-RAGE because it provides good contrast between white matter and cortex. However, due to susceptibility artifact coming from the air-tissue interface (Fig. 1), a reliable and accurate measurement is difficult in the regions near the air-bone interface for T1-wieghted schemes. One way to alleviate this problem is to perform gray matter spin-echo imaging through double inversion recovery (DIR) sequence. The sequence selectively suppresses the signal from c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) and white matter using two inversion recovery pulses [1]. One drawback of the DIR sequence, however, is its long scan time. For high resolution 3D DIR imaging, orders on the order ±20 minutes can be required for full k-space coverage. This can be effectively reduced by using from a variety of parallel imaging schemes. The objective of this study was to determine the influence of undersampling with parallel imaging on cortical thickness measurements using a DIR acquisition scheme. Here, we applied one of the parallel imaging reconstruction schemes, namely, the Generalized Autocalibrating Partially Parallel Acquisition (GRAPPA) [2] scheme to DIR imaging to evaluate measurement changes as a function of reduction factor.
